Maemo and Moblin Merge into MeeGo [Video]

Apparently there will be one less mobile phone operating system out there, Nokia and Intel have announced that they will combine their mobile software platforms into one. The new platform will be named MeeGo — more info here — and will work in smartphones, netbooks, MIDs and other mobile devices. MeeGo is a Linux-based software [...]

Nokia Unveils N900 Tablet with Maemo 5

Nokia has decided to announce its N900 tablet before the Nokia World next week, which featuring Linux-based Maemo software and a full touch screen. Running on the new Maemo 5 software, the Nokia N900 supports multi tasking and packs a powerful ARM Cortex-A8 processor, up to 1GB of application memory and OpenGL ES 2.0 graphics [...]
